Key Expense Categories for Vending Mechanics

Tracking categories is essential for Vending Mechanics to understand where their money goes, identify cost-saving opportunities, and ensure profitability.

Category Description Examples
Inventory Supplies Cost of products sold in vending machines Snacks, beverages, health bars
Machine Repairs Expenses for maintaining and fixing machines Replacement parts, service fees
Location Rental Fees for placing machines at locations Gym contracts, office building agreements
Licensing Fees Costs for permits to operate vending machines Food handling permits, business licenses
Transportation Expenses related to moving products and machines Fuel costs, vehicle maintenance
Insurance Protection against potential losses Liability insurance, property insurance
Utility Costs Electricity and water fees for machines Power bills for refrigerated machines
Marketing Expenses Promotions to increase sales Flyers, social media ads
Employee Wages Salaries for workers managing vending operations Part-time staff, technicians
Packaging Costs Expenses for product packaging Plastic wrappers, branded boxes
Maintenance Supplies Items needed for routine upkeep Cleaning materials, tools
Training Costs Expenses for employee skill development Workshops, online courses
Point of Sale Systems Costs associated with payment processing Card readers, software subscriptions
